City of Erie Police on Thursday issued arrest warrants for four people in a robbery turned murder at a short-term rental home earlier this year.

Julia Gaerttner, 32, of Lawrence Park; Marsea Jones, 20, of Erie; Jamie Smith Jr., 20, of Erie; and Derrick S. Wright, 35, of Erie, are each charged with homicide, second-degree murder, robbery and other offenses.

The three male suspects were already in prison. Police arrested Gaerttner on Thursday.

The four are accused of barging into a short-term rental house on McClelland Ave. the early morning of Jan. 27 to rob the people inside.

One of the people inside fired back, and 30-year-old Erie resident Shannon Crosby was killed in the shootout, according to police.

The people inside the house were from Arizona and admitted to police to travelling to Erie in order to sell fentanyl pills to a local contact for $30,000, police said.

The arrests follow an 11-month-long investigation involving forensic evidence, eyewitnesses and consultation with the district attorney's office.
